What is the difference between a single-piece and two-piece space saving toilet?
A single-piece space saving toilet is a compact, self-contained unit that combines the toilet bowl and tank into one piece. This design provides a sleek and modern appearance, making it a popular choice for contemporary bathrooms. On the other hand, a two-piece space saving toilet consists of a separate toilet bowl and tank, which are connected by a plumbing system. According to a study by the Plumbing-Heating-Cooling Contractors Association, two-piece toilets are more common and often less expensive than single-piece toilets.
In terms of maintenance and repair, two-piece toilets are generally easier to work with, as the tank and bowl can be repaired or replaced separately. However, single-piece toilets are often more challenging to repair, as the entire unit may need to be replaced if a problem occurs. On the other hand, single-piece toilets are less prone to leaks and are generally easier to clean, as there are fewer crevices and seams where dirt and bacteria can accumulate. Ultimately, the choice between a single-piece and two-piece space saving toilet depends on your personal preferences, budget, and maintenance needs.

What are the most common types of flushing systems used in space saving toilets?
The most common types of flushing systems used in space saving toilets include gravity-fed, pressure-assist, and dual-flush systems. Gravity-fed toilets use the force of gravity to flush waste down the drain, while pressure-assist toilets use a combination of water pressure and gravity to remove waste. Dual-flush toilets, on the other hand, offer two flushing options: a full flush for solid waste and a reduced flush for liquid waste. According to the EPA, dual-flush toilets can save up to 20% more water than traditional toilets.
In addition to these common flushing systems, some space saving toilets also feature advanced technologies, such as vacuum-assist or macerating systems. Vacuum-assist toilets use a vacuum pump to remove waste, while macerating systems use a grinding mechanism to break down waste into smaller particles. These systems can be particularly useful in areas with low water pressure or limited plumbing infrastructure. By choosing a space saving toilet with an efficient flushing system, you can minimize water usage while maintaining effective waste removal and hygiene.
